如何升級Workerman到最新版本?

要升級workerman到最新版本,應遵循以下步驟:1.備份當前項目;2.通過composer更新workerman;3.檢查代碼兼容性;4.進行全面測試;5.部署到生產環境。升級時需注意版本差異、依賴問題和性能優化

如何升級Workerman到最新版本?

升級Workerman到最新版本是一項常見的需求,尤其是在需要利用最新功能或修復已知問題時。Workerman作為一個高性能的php應用服務器,它的升級過程相對簡單,但也有一些需要注意的細節和最佳實踐。

要升級Workerman到最新版本,首先需要確定當前版本和最新版本之間的差異,這可以通過查看官方gitHub倉庫或Workerman的官方網站來實現。通常,升級過程包括以下幾個步驟:

  1. 備份當前項目:在進行任何升級之前,備份當前的項目是非常必要的。這不僅可以防止升級過程中可能出現的問題,還可以作為一個回滾的選項。

  2. 更新Workerman:可以通過composer來更新Workerman。假設你的項目已經使用Composer管理依賴,只需運行以下命令:

composer update workerman/workerman

這個命令會自動將Workerman更新到最新版本。如果你使用的是全局安裝的Workerman,可以通過以下命令更新:

composer global update workerman/workerman
  1. 檢查兼容性:升級后,需要檢查你的代碼是否與新版本兼容。Workerman的更新可能會引入新的API或更改現有的API,因此需要確保你的代碼能夠正常運行。

  2. 測試:在正式部署前,進行全面的測試是必不可少的。可以使用不同的環境來測試升級后的Workerman,確保所有功能正常工作。

  3. 部署:確認測試通過后,可以將升級后的Workerman部署到生產環境中。

在升級過程中,有一些需要注意的點:

  • 版本差異:Workerman的不同版本之間可能存在較大的API變化,升級前需要仔細閱讀變更日志,了解這些變化。
  • 依賴問題:Workerman可能依賴其他庫,升級Workerman可能會導致這些依賴庫也需要更新,確保所有依賴都兼容。
  • 性能優化:新版本可能包含性能優化,但在實際環境中,性能可能會有所不同,建議進行性能測試。

我曾在一次項目中升級Workerman到最新版本,遇到了一個有趣的問題:新版本引入了一個新的配置選項,導致之前的配置文件不再有效。這讓我意識到,在升級前仔細閱讀變更日志是多么重要。最終,通過調整配置文件,我成功地完成了升級,并且項目性能得到了顯著提升。

總的來說,升級Workerman到最新版本是一個相對簡單的過程,但需要仔細規劃和測試,以確保升級的順利進行。通過遵循上述步驟和注意事項,你可以安全地將Workerman升級到最新版本,享受最新的功能和性能優化。

? 版權聲明
THE END
喜歡就支持一下吧
點贊14 分享